   > I was able to disassemble the camera, reseat the ribbon cable,   
   > confirm that the switch is working, and reassemble everything.   
   > But nothing has changed, The LCD is still dead. So it may be   
   > some problem on the main board. I would have no way to fix that,   
   > even assuming I could identify the exact problem. So I'll   
   > probably look for a used replacement for the camcorder.   
      
   Look at the ribbon cable carefully with magnification.  The problems with   
   these is not that the cable gets loose but that there are small cracks in the   
   cable itself.   
   It is possible that there is a problem with the board as well.  Look for small   
   SMD caps that may have leaked in the area.  These too can cause problems of   
   various types in cameras of that age.
